Former Jihadi Commander, Two Taliban Shadow District Governors Killed in Afghanistan

A former Jihadi commander and two Taliban shadow district governors were killed in a clash between the rival groups in Northern Samangan province.

Mohammad Sediq Azizi, the spokesman for the acting governor of Samangan province, said that the clash erupted in Zeeraki village of Dara-i-Sof Payan, Khaama press reported.

He said Mullah Mohammad Karim, a former Jihadi commander, was heading towards the village mosque for prayers alongside his forces when Taliban militants surrounded them.

He said a clash erupted between the two sides, which left Karim and four of his bodyguards killed.

Aziz further said that Qari Shamsullah alias Qari Shamshad the Taliban so-called governor for Roy Dwab District, Mawlawi Bozarg the Taliban shadow governor for Dar-i-Sof Payen District and Niamatullah the Taliban commander for Dara-i-Sof Payen District were also killed in the clash.

According to Azizi, Taliban have also kidnapped four civilians from the same village after the clash.
